Why the Gut Microbiome Is Such a Big Deal for Kids
The microbiome isn't just involved in digestion, though it certainly plays a big role there. Research over the past decade has linked gut bacteria to immune system development, mental health, inflammation regulation, nutrient absorption, and even how the brain functions. In children, whose immune systems and nervous systems are still maturing, a healthy and diverse microbiome seems to be especially important.
When the balance of gut bacteria gets thrown off—a state researchers call dysbiosis—kids can experience everything from digestive discomfort and increased susceptibility to illness, to mood changes and irregular appetite. The tricky part is that dysbiosis doesn't always announce itself loudly. Sometimes the signs are subtle: looser stools, a sudden pickiness about food, or just seeming a little "off."
The Medications Most Likely to Affect Your Child's Gut Bacteria
Antibiotics
This one probably isn't a surprise. Antibiotics are literally designed to kill bacteria—but they can't distinguish between the harmful bacteria causing your kid's ear infection and the beneficial bacteria helping regulate their digestion and immunity. A single course of broad-spectrum antibiotics can reduce the diversity of gut bacteria significantly, and in young children, some studies suggest it can take weeks to months for the microbiome to fully recover. Repeated courses—common in kids who get frequent ear infections or strep—may compound this effect.
Acid Reducers (PPIs and H2 Blockers)
Proton pump inhibitors like omeprazole, and H2 blockers like famotidine, are sometimes prescribed for kids with acid reflux or GERD. These medications work by reducing stomach acid—which sounds straightforward enough. But stomach acid is actually one of the body's natural defenses against pathogens. When acid levels drop, certain bacteria that wouldn't normally thrive in the stomach can survive and migrate into the gut. Studies in adults have shown that long-term PPI use is associated with altered gut microbiome composition, and while the pediatric research is still catching up, the concern is real enough that many pediatric gastroenterologists are cautious about long-term use in kids.
ADHD Stimulant Medications
Medications like amphetamine salts (Adderall) and methylphenidate (Ritalin, Concerta) affect appetite and digestion in ways that can indirectly impact the gut microbiome. Because these stimulants often suppress appetite—sometimes significantly—kids taking them may eat less overall, and particularly less of the fiber-rich foods that feed beneficial gut bacteria. Reduced food diversity means reduced microbial diversity. There's also some early-stage research suggesting that stimulant medications may directly affect gut motility, though this area needs more study.
What You Can Actually Do: Food Strategies That Support the Microbiome
Here's the good news: food is genuinely one of the most powerful tools you have for supporting your child's gut health during and after medication courses. You don't need special supplements or expensive products—though some of those may help too. What you need is a strategy.
Load Up on Fiber-Rich Foods
Dietary fiber is essentially food for good gut bacteria. The bacteria that thrive on fiber—called prebiotics when we eat them—produce short-chain fatty acids that help maintain the gut lining and regulate inflammation. Good sources for kids include oats, beans, lentils, bananas, apples, pears, and whole grains. If your child is a picky eater, even small amounts matter. Tossing white beans into a soup or slipping oats into a smoothie counts.
Bring in the Fermented Foods
Foods like plain yogurt with live cultures, kefir, and—for adventurous older kids—kimchi, miso, and sauerkraut contain live beneficial bacteria that can help replenish what medications displace. Plain yogurt with live and active cultures is usually the easiest sell for American kids. Look for the phrase "live and active cultures" on the label; not all yogurts contain them in meaningful amounts.
If your child is on antibiotics, it's worth giving yogurt or kefir at a different time of day than the antibiotic dose—spacing them out by a couple of hours helps ensure the bacteria in the food aren't killed off before they can do any good.
Diversify the Plate
Research consistently shows that dietary diversity is one of the strongest predictors of microbiome diversity. That doesn't mean forcing your kid to eat 30 different vegetables a week—it means trying to rotate through a variety of fruits, vegetables, grains, and proteins rather than cycling through the same five meals. Even small swaps help: try purple cabbage instead of iceberg lettuce, or swap white rice for brown or farro occasionally.
Consider a Pediatric Probiotic (With Some Caveats)
Probiotics are live bacteria sold as supplements, and they've gotten a lot of attention in recent years. The evidence for their use in kids is mixed and depends heavily on the specific strain and the specific situation. For antibiotic-associated diarrhea, certain strains—particularly Lactobacillus rhamnosus GG and Saccharomyces boulardii—have reasonably good evidence behind them. For general microbiome support, the picture is less clear.
If you're considering a probiotic for your child, talk to your pediatrician first. Not all probiotics are created equal, dosing matters, and some aren't appropriate for kids with certain health conditions.
A Note on Timing
For kids on antibiotics specifically, starting gut-supportive strategies early—ideally from day one of the medication course—seems to be more effective than waiting until after the course is finished. Think of it as building a protective foundation while the medication does its job.
For kids on longer-term medications like acid reducers or ADHD stimulants, a consistent, fiber-rich, diverse diet becomes even more important as a daily baseline rather than a short-term fix.
